About Two Rocks
Two Rocks is a coastal urban locality approximately 60 kilometres north of Perth CBD, located within the City of Wanneroo in Perth's fast-growing northern corridor. With a population of 3,822 (up from 2,990 in 2016), the suburb has seen significant growth as families and first-home buyers are attracted by its relative affordability and coastal lifestyle. The median household income of $1,526 per week is moderate, and housing is predominantly low-density detached homes on newer estates, reflecting the suburb's character as a developing outer-suburban area.
Two Rocks sits adjacent to the Indian Ocean coastline, offering residents access to beaches and the Two Rocks Marina, a local hub for recreational fishing and boating. The Yanchep National Park and the nearby township of Yanchep provide additional recreation options and local services. The suburb is served by the Joondalup Line from Yanchep Station (approximately 8 kilometres south), providing a rail connection to Perth CBD, while local Transperth bus routes link residents to the station and surrounding areas.
Two Rocks falls under postcode 6037 and is governed by the Wanneroo Council (Local Government Area). For federal elections, residents vote in the electorate of Pearce, while state elections fall under the Butler electorate.

Country of Birth 2021 Census
Top Countries of Birth (excl. Australia)
- 1. England 505
- 2. New Zealand 167
- 3. South Africa 75
- 4. Scotland 34
- 5. Germany 26
- 6. Ireland 24
- 7. Wales 21
- 8. Zimbabwe 19
- 9. Netherlands 16
- 10. United States 16
